Beef Gallstones: Formation and Incidence
The development of beef gallstones, also known as gall calculi, is a typical problem, particularly in older animals. They develop due to the excess of gall salts, pigments, and cholesterol within the bile sac. Various causes, including a excessive diet, overweight condition, worm infestations, and family history, can lead to this condition. Figures suggest that the incidence of cholelithiasis in cattle can be from 5% to as much as 30%, based on the group's maturity and management practices.
Bovine Gallstones: Gathering and Processing
The collection of ox gallstones is a particular practice, typically undertaken following the butchering of cattle for meat. Extraction involves carefully separating the gallstones from the gallbladder, an structure located near the liver. The process must be managed with precision to avoid contamination and ensure integrity. Following harvesting , the gallstones often undergo an initial washing stage, frequently employing water and sometimes a mild detergent . Further treatment may include evaporation – traditionally sun-drying, but increasingly using regulated heat – to reduce humidity and prepare them for subsequent use. Guidelines regarding the collection and refinement of animal by-products, including gallstones, vary considerably depending on national laws and trade agreements.
